Indiana Administrative Code
Title 312 - NATURAL RESOURCES COMMISSION
Article 25 - COAL MINING AND RECLAMATION OPERATIONS
Rule 6 - Performance Standards
Section 6-85 - Underground mining; hydrologic balance; underground mine entry and access discharges
Current through March 20, 2024
Authority: IC 14-34-2-1
Affected: IC 14-34
Sec. 85.
(a) Surface entries and access to underground workings, including adits and slopes, shall be located, designed, constructed, and utilized to prevent or control gravity discharge of water from the mine.
(b) Gravity discharge of water from an underground mine, other than a drift mine subject to subsection (c), may be allowed by the director if either of the following is demonstrated:
(c) Notwithstanding anything to the contrary in subsections (a) and (b), for a drift mine first used after the implementation of this program and located in acid-producing or iron-producing coal seams, surface entries and accesses shall be located in such a manner as to prevent any gravity discharge from the mine unless another location is approved by the director.
